[{"type":"text","content":"\n\n\n\nVANCOUVER, March 3 /CNW/ - The Board of Directors of Finlay Minerals Ltd.\n("The Company") is pleased to announce the results of core drilling from the\n700 meter long Atlas East gold-silver zone, as well as preliminary evaluation\nof the Pillar East gold-silver occurrence 1,000 meters east of the Atlas East\nzone, on the Pil North property, Toodoggone Mining Camp, B.C.\n\n\nHighlight results from Atlas East core drill program include,\n\n\nAE07-03\n\n Drilled\n From To width\n(meters) (meters) (meters) Au (g/t) Ag (g/t)\n\n149.15 151.15 2 1.290 28.4\n151.15 153.15 2 5.220 31.2\n153.15 155.15 2 0.051 3.1\n155.15 157.15 2 2.870 57\n157.15 159.15 2 7.240 141.1\ncomposite\n149.15 159.15 10 3.33 52.1\n\n\nThe Atlas East zone has been traced in drilling for ~700 meters along\nstrike from AE07-07 in the west to the AE07-04/06 drill-hole pair in the east.\nFurther east the favourable volcanic unit containing gold-silver\nmineralization is buried beneath younger volcanic rocks. Management believes\nthat the Pillar East zone, 1,000 meters to the east is the eastward\ncontinuation of the same mineralized zone as the Atlas East zone.\n\n\nAt the Pillar East zone soil samples returned up to 6,748ppb gold\n(6.75g/t gold), while visible gold was panned out of the headwaters of several\nstreams with pan concentrate grades of up to 4,280ppb gold (4.28g/t gold).\nConsiderable more exploration is needed at Pillar East including trenching and\ndrilling in a largely scree covered mountain bowl (see map on web-site).\n\n\nMineralization at the Atlas East zone is associated with weakly pyritic,\nsericitic, silicified, and quartz stock-work andesite porphyry containing\ntrace amounts of sphalerite and galena. The gross overall orientation of the\nmineralized zone, considering the 2007 work, is presently best estimated at an\neast-northeast trend with a moderate south dip.
